Which One Is Right for You?
King Louis XIII and London Pound Cake are both excellent strains with distinct characteristics. King Louis XIII is a Hybrid with 21–25% THC, while London Pound Cake is a Indica with 26–29% THC. Your choice depends on your preference for effects, growing difficulty, and intended use.
Choose King Louis XIII if you want more cerebral/uplifting effects. King Louis is an Indica dominant hybrid cannabis, whose genetics are not known yet.
Choose London Pound Cake if you want higher THC potency, deeper body relaxation. London Poundcake is an indica dominant hybrid strain created through crossing the delicious Sunset Sherbet with another indica-heavy hybrid strain.
